Porphyry Mountain Mines Company Mine

Porphyry Mountain Mines Company Mine is a quarry in , and has an elevation of 10,069 feet.
Tap on a place
to explore it
  • Type: Quarry
  • Description: mine in Pitkin County, Colorado, United States of America
